Question: Can the alcohol be recycled?

I read on a different post about exposing the alcohol to a UV light. All the remaining resin is cured and falls to the bottom; afterwards the alcohol is passed trough some paper towels (as filter) to collect all the cured resin pigments and the alcohol is left like new. I experienced a similar thing. I used to have my cleaning tanks away from the light, but when I moved to a new office and placed the tanks next to the window, I noticed something “wrong” with the alcohol… it had now a white jelly that wasn’t there before. I removed some of that jelly, the rest has deposited on the bottom and the alcohol looks like new.
